Resumen del Editor

If you’re ready to ignite a fire deep inside of your soul to become the very best version of yourself personally and professionally, this book is for you.

One Percent Better is a story about a 20-year veteran schoolteacher who’s lost his passion, lost his energy, lost his fire—for his job, and for life. Joe Bigelow, aka “Mr. Big”, is gearing up to start another school year, and even as he’s walking into the building for the first in-service of the year, he’s counting down the days until next summer.

His principal has placed him on a professional improvement plan at school and his wife has placed him on a personal improvement plan at home.

Mr. Big’s life has become one monotonous, go-through-the-motions day after the next. He’s tired of it—and he knows something has to change—but what?

Through what seems to be a continual series of bad luck, Mr. Big meets an unlikely mentor who begins to help him put the puzzle pieces together, providing the guidance Mr. Big needs to regain his passion for teaching and passion for waking up excited to bring the juice each and every day.

In this truly unforgettable and relatable journey, Brian Cain, international best-selling author and world-renowned mental performance coach, will show you how to close the gap from where you are to where you want to be by harnessing the power of simply getting one percent better.

Who will benefit from this book? Executives, people in sales, teachers, coaches, and school personnel who may be:

  • Lacking the energy, drive, and passion they once had
  • Wanting to become a better teacher, leader, or coach—but aren’t sure where to start or how to stay consistent
  • Looking to improve engagement from their students/athletes and become a leader amongst staff

Rediscover your passion. Reignite the fire you once had for your career. Get one percent better—intentionally—every single day.

Quit selling yourself

While the story was good and had a lot of great points, every chapter Brian was continually mentioning his own name and plugging himself. I stopped listening to the book because I didn't want to hear his name one more time. It seemed to be more about Brian than the reader.
